Description
A spread spectrum communication system which transmits frame signals composed of a frequency set modulated with a signature shift frequency is proposed. Some frequency sets are selectee so that the absolute values of the time sequence corresponding to a signature are constant and the cross-correlation among the sequences with different signature shift frequencies becomes small. To enhance the SN ratio at a receiver and to reduce the shift frequency spacing, Extended Frame Fourier Analysis is applied for the demodulation process. The computer simulation results on the interference tolerance capability are shown.
